    It is up to the scammers to prove they have identified the driver on each and every occasion, beyond whatever balance of proof is required in a Scottish court. In England and Wales this is the balance of probabilities, in other words over 50%. With three named drivers and (possibly) regular users, then the balance of probabilities that it was one individual is 1/3 thus failing the requirements for a court to find for the claimant.

    Problems would occur for the defendant if the location was say a place of work, and the scammers can prove the keeper was an employer at that location.
    Conversely, if the location was a place of work but the keeper worked elsewhere, or was/is retired, then that would help the defendant. 

    If the keeper was not the driver at all, then that should say so, and put the scammers to strict proof that the contrary is true. Proof of not being the driver should be provided if possible, even if it is a few examples. 
    If the keeper was not the driver on some occasions then put the scammers to strict proof as above, and provide proof they were not the driver on a few sample occasions. 

    Have you checked with the DVLA who and when accessed the keeper's personal data from just before the date of the first PCN until now in order to establish that the scammers applied for keeper details each and every time as opposed to recycling their existing data?
